Scams Mystery boxes give you an element of excitement and excitement that is often missing from traditional e-commerce. The popularity of these products also leads to an increase in fraud. Sellers can advertise items of high value which aren't in fact included, which can leave consumers disappointed and out of pocket. The risk of fraud is especially significant for buyers who purchase from unknown sellers on social media. Scammers employ videos that entice to convince consumers to buy mystery boxes. These videos show pallets of iPhones Xboxes 4K TVs and Xboxes being sold at unbelievable prices. They feature text overlays and countdowns that create a false sense of urgency. Scammers direct victims to fake domain names that resemble Amazon's website. They urge users to input their credit card numbers however, once they enter the information is stolen and used for fraudulent purchases. The scammers then disappear along with the victims' money as well as items. Another type of scam is the selling of boxes that contain knockoffs or other products that are not licensed. These boxes can contain everything from footwear, clothing and collectibles, to beauty products and cosmetics. These boxes are filled with items that are usually cheap and of low quality, which makes buyers who expect premium products feel cheated. Attempts to contact the sellers to get refunds or exchanges are not successful, since the sellers' telephone numbers and email addresses don't work. The scammers may also request wire transfers or cryptocurrency in order to avoid detection.
